Driving Innovation in Lithium Production
Intrepid Potash, Inc. (NYSE: IPI), Aquatech International, LLC, and Adionics have embarked on an ambitious journey to bring forth a lithium processing facility, marking a significant milestone in the development of essential national critical minerals. This initiative is taking place at Intrepid's facility in Wendover, utilizing brine to create battery-grade lithium carbonate, crucial for energy storage solutions.
Success in Lithium Extraction Testing
The recent testing results have showcased an impressive extraction capability, achieving a lithium extraction rate of 92.9% from the brine, with a lithium chloride purity exceeding 99.5%. This impressive yield not only proves the feasibility of capitalizing on Wendover's brine but also emphasizes the potential of this collaboration among the three companies. Aquatech further refined the lithium into battery-grade material, solidifying the practical application of their joint efforts in the realm of lithium processing.

Collaboration Framework and Future Plans
The three companies are working under a Joint Development Agreement (JDA), a structured agreement designed to facilitate comprehensive feasibility studies and detailed engineering of a proposed 5,000 metric ton lithium extraction facility. Their ambitious goal is to reach a final investment decision by 2026, laying the foundation for a state-of-the-art lithium production facility that will help meet the increasing demand for lithium in various industries.
The Path Forward
This collaboration not only aims to advance the project design but also entails negotiating definitive agreements to enable the construction and operation of the lithium extraction facility. The expectation is that the facility will utilize both existing infrastructure and innovative technologies from Aquatech and Adionics, which are specifically tailored for effective lithium recovery from brines.
